The plant has been fed double whammy nutes resulting in nute burn; lose the MG for this phase, it's totally not needed and the rating is not the right for the phase your in anyway. You could bring it back for flow but MG is basically the C student of nutes. It will pass but it's not much of a performer. I once thought MG was fine but then I saw what Fox Farm could do.

Flush the plants; tap water is fine. Use the cold faucet and let in run for at least 30 secs before you fill up, let the water sit out 24hrs or at least overnight. You could also buy distilled water if you don't have time to let water sit. Give a few days maybe a week after the flush for the plant to stabalize ensuring the ph is balanced before nutes are re-applied. Feed through the soil this time. Foliar feeding is best for plants that are deficient. Using that method for regular feeding increases the potential for over dose.
